During your analyst stint, how many quit early without having their next plans lined up? What percentage completes the full 2 years?

I only knew of a couple that quit without anything lined up. If anyone quit early, it was usually because they had secured a new job. I would approximate maybe 85% of the class finished at least 2 years?
80% of my class stayed for at least two years. Everyone who quit early had another job lined up. One guy got fired a little over a year in but that was a complete anomaly.
If you don't mind, would you be able to share generally what he did to get fired? Was it just bad performance or is was it something royally stupid like fucking the MD's daughter (someone I know did that).
Awful attitude and performance. Smart guy but super weird and lazy. Dude would sit around all day doing nothing, leave whenever he wanted, get into arguments with associates, abandon first year analysts that he was double staffed with, etc. I have no idea how he got a return offer to begin with.
